Around and Around Our most important exhibition to-date has toured to four locations. The exhibition was produced in cooperation with Galerie Achim Kubinski, Berlin, and Doual'Art in Cameroon, among many others. |
| 1998 | Vielfaches Echo A major project in cooperation with the Stuttgart Department of Culture, the Staatsgalerie, the Gallery of the City of Stuttgart and many others - a total of 12 participating museums and ten galleries. It became known as the Stuttgart Model due to its non-hierarchical collaboration structure. |

200 Years of Metalwork from Africa A controversial exhibition because its premise contained several theories that contradicted accepted ethnological and art historical assessments. This link will take you to the Stuttgart exhibition, which also includes detailed information... |
Dreierkonferenz (Three-way conference) A harmonious combination of three very different artists with only their African heritage in common. Owusu-Ankomah, Lawson Oyekan and Aboudramane. November - December 2000 |
